Problemas com JavaDB
22/10/2013 11:41
0
Pessoal, estou enfrentando um problema ao tentar usar o JavaDB. Sempre que rodo o app me vêm o problema:
No suitable driver found for jdbc:derby://localhost:1527/meuDB


Já coloquei a dependencia:
compile 'org.apache.derby:derby:10.8.2.2'

(já tentei adicionando o jar na pasta lib e deixar a pasta lib em branco)

Meu datasource.groovy ficou assim:
dataSource {
pooled = false
driverClassName = "org.apache.derby.jdbc.EmbeddedDriver"
username = "user"
password = "pass"
}

hibernate {
cache.use_second_level_cache = true
cache.use_query_cache = false
cache.region.factory_class = 'net.sf.ehcache.hibernate.EhCacheRegionFactory'
}

environments {
development {
dataSource {
dbCreate = "update"
url = "jdbc:derby://localhost:1527/meuDB"
}
}
...
}


Preciso de um DB embutido para testar o app e estou ficando louco com isso

Agradeço a atenção de todos.
Tags: Grails, JavaDB, Derby, banco de dados, embutido


0
Olá, Igo

O Grails versão 2.2.3 tinha um bug nesse sentido. É o seu caso?


0
Yoshi, estou a usar 2.2.4


0
Não colocou essa depêndencia na closure de plugins? Porque não é lá. Uma vez coloquei uma dependência lá por engano.

Outrossim, quando manda fazer um "refresh-dependencies" olhou com calma o log para ver se nenhuma exceção ocorreu?


0
A dependência está no bildConfig e o refresh não retornou nada.
Mas graças a Deus resolvi o problema maior, que era o de conseguir um banco para testes, consegui fazer o H2 funcionar sem apagar os dados a cada reinício do app.

Obrigado pela tentativa.

Não vou fechar o post porque o meu problema maior foi resolvido, mas o do título continua (em outros projetos).

PS.: Aos que chegarem aqui pelo google, o H2 funcionou alterando o dbcreate e retirando o ":men" do endereço do banco.

PS2.: KikoLobo, grande guru, o grailsbrasil poderia avisar por email quando uma resposta a um post meu for inserida (só uma sugestão).



Ainda não faz parte da comunidade???

Para se registrar, clique aqui.


Aprenda Groovy e Grails com a Formação itexto!

Newsletter Semana Groovy

Assinar

Envie seu link!


Livro de Grails


/dev/All

Os melhores blogs de TI (e em português) em um único lugar!

 
Creative Commons
RSS Grails Brasil é mantido por itexto Consultoria.
Em caso de problemas contacte Henrique Lobo Weissmann (Kico) por e-mail: kico@itexto.com.br
Todo o conteúdo presente neste site adota o Creative Commons como licença padrão.
Ver: 4.14.0
itexto